The Los Angeles Kings showed great promise in the ''' 2005-06 NHL Season '''. During the off-season, they acquired centers Pavol Demitra and Jeremy Roenick to help solidify their offense, as well as goaltender Jason LaBarbera . But injuries plagued the team again, as they fell six points short of a playoff spot, causing them to miss out on the postseason for the third consecutive season. Problems late in the year led to the firing of head coach Andy Murray and General Manager Dave Taylor . The Kings would head into the 2006 offseason looking to rebuild and try to get back to a playoff-caliber team.
